This foundation looks amazing on the skin and is perfect for those that want a natural-looking foundation that still offers coverage. This review is on the shade Porcelain.
The formula is almost a liquid and blends very well and quickly. I have tried this foundation with a few different primers and I find that it works best with a silicon based primer. I was first using this with a glycerin based primer and did not like the way it sat on my skin. I apply it with a flat top brush and buff it into my skin. This has a light to medium coverage and has a matte/satin finish; looks like skin.
This lasts fine on oily skin but it does melt around my nose where I’m the most oily. It doesn’t control my oils at all but when I blotted and powdered every 4 hours or so it lasted fine. Around my jaw where I’m not oily, it lasted the entire day; more than 8 hours.
The shade porcelain is a touch too light for me so the shades are true to color and even a bit lighter. I like that it has a yellow undertone rather than pink which most light ivory/porcelain shades have.

The packaging is great; it has a pump and it pushes the product out so there is no product left. It is plastic and very light weight; perfect for travel. Overall, I like this foundation for days when my skin feels a bit dry and I like that it looks natural on the skin. This has SPF 15 which is great but I do not think that it is sufficient enough to prevent sunburn. Arbonne products do not contain talc, parabens, mineral oil, etc.

What’s the difference between a silicon and glycerin based primer? I always hear about those two but always opt for silicon ones.
LikeLiked by 1 person
Silicon helps fill in pores and fine lines, it also makes your foundation glide on. Glycerin helps the foundation stick to the face, it’s great for prolonging face makeup. Hope that helps 🙂
